Chemical tanker shipping is a key part of international bulk liquid chemical shipping, which serves many industries including industrial manufacturing, agriculture, pharmaceuticals, and food processing. The tankers are designed to transport a range of hazardous and non-hazardous chemicals safely and economically on inland, coastal, and deep-sea routes. Because of the rate of global industrialization and a surge in chemical demand, there is a requirement for efficient, regulated, and sure means of transportation that has triggered this market's importance. CHEMICAL TANKER SHIPPING MARKET SEGMENTATION
By Type
Based on type, the global market is categorised into Inland Chemical Tankers (1,000-4,999 DWT), Coastal Chemical Tankers (5,000-9,999 DWT), and Deep-Sea Chemical Tankers (10,000-50,000 DWT).
- Inland Chemical Tankers (1,000-4,999 DWT): Inland chemical tankers cover short distances on canals, lakes, and rivers. The lower DWT of their vessels allows for operations in inland waterways, and they carry out mainly domestic chemical distribution.
- Coastal Chemical Tankers (5,000-9,999 DWT): Chemical tankers have operations in nearshore and inter-regional sea lanes. They are convenient in delivering chemicals between ports that cannot support the use of deep-sea vessels and find extensive use for archipelagic country distribution and along coasts.
- Deep-Sea Chemical Tankers (10,000-50,000 DWT): Worldwide leadership in unique chemical exports can be seen for deep-water tankers carrying chemical cargo, as they are particularly equipped to cater to long-oceanic hauls. Complying with the most up-to-date standards of safety with huge capacity, they are preferred to ship harmful and bulk liquid chemicals across oceans.
By Application
Based on application, the global market is classified into Organic Chemicals, Vegetable Oils & Fats, Inorganic Chemicals, and Others.
- Organic chemicals: Organic chemicals include petrochemicals, alcohols, and solvents that are raw materials for consumer and industrial goods. They require highly specialized tankers that must be temperature-controlled and contamination-resistant. Fertilizers, alkalis, and acids are among the inorganic chemicals that are transported in bulk and must be shipped in corrosion-resistant tanks.
- Vegetable Oils & Fats: Vegetable oils and fats business is driven by food processing, cosmetics, and the biofuel industries. Here, the tankers need to maintain hygienic standards and prevention of rancidity.
- Others: Specialty and pharmaceutical chemicals in the 'Others' segment are specialty and pharma chemicals typically exported in small volume with high precision and high-quality control and niche but high-margin businesses. Restraining Factor
"Stringent International Regulations Governing The Handling And Transport Of Hazardous Chemicals To Potentially Impede Market Growth"
But the market is beset by stringent worldwide regulation of hazardous chemical handling and transport. Compliance with various systems such as MARPOL, REACH, and GHS contributes to operating costs and complexities for tanker companies. Periodic inspections, compulsory retrofitting of safety equipment, and training of crews also cost smaller operators, restricting their scope for expansion of operations.

Challenge
"Volatility in Crude Oil Prices Could Be a Potential Challenge for Consumers"
Perhaps the most important challenge to the market is volatility in crude oil prices, whose direct effect lands on bunker fuel price — an important component of the operating expense for chemical tankers. Unpredictable fuel prices may result in unpredictable freight prices and affect customer and shipper bargaining in contract terms. Volatility added unpredictability to profitability and deterred long-term investment in the renewal of the fleet and the fleet expansion, particularly by smaller shipping companies.
